Analysis
In 2024, castor oil seeds — gross production index number in Western Africa stood at 100.58.
That represents a change of up 0.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, castor oil seeds — gross production index number in Western Africa peaked at 203.9 in 1962 and was at its lowest, 67.67, in 1968.
Western Africa ranks 13th of 20 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 64 years of available data.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
